 Fixed #36865 -- Removed casting from exact lookups in admin searches.

 Instead of casting non-text fields to CharField (which prevents index
 usage), skip exact lookups when the search term fails
 formfield.to_python().

 This preserves index usage for valid searches while gracefully handling
 invalid search terms by simply not including them in the query for that
 field.

 For multi-term searches like 'foo 123' on search_fields=['name',
 'age__exact']:
 - 'foo': invalid for age, so only name lookup is used
 - '123': valid for both, so both lookups are used

 This entails a slight increase in permissiveness for search terms that
 can be normalized by formfield.to_python().
